What you will do
As the Senior Engineer Advanced Operations you will provide process engineering support for new product launches in neurosurgical instruments; working with Marketing R&D OperationsAdvancedSourcing Advanced Quality and Validation teams. They serve as the voice of operations in the development process and work on design for manufacturability and assembly. This position is responsible for process design development and validation in new product development.Job responsibilities include:
- Working closely with internal and external contract manufacturers to develop processes for electromechanical assembly including PCBA manufacturing potting conformal coating soldering pressing laser welding laser marking torquing and manual assembly.
- Leads or support capital acquisition activity from specifying equipment contract negotiation installation and validation.
- Ensure quality of process and product as defined in the appropriate operation and material specifications.
- Select components and equipment based on analysis of specifications reliability and regulatory requirements.
- Work with quality engineers to develop component specific testing and inspection protocols.
- Analyze equipment to establish operating data conduct experimental test and result analysis.
- Lead and/or participate in process review meetings.
- Lead and develop Process Failure Mode and Effect Analysis (PFMEA) Control Plan SOP and Production Part Approval Process (PPAP) generation associated with launches.
- Development review and approval of validation documentation.
